Optimize Your YouTube Channel

Your channel should not only be visually appealing but also informative to attract potential clients.

  • Professional Branding โ€” Create a consistent look with logos, banners, and thumbnails that appeal to kids and their parents.
  • SEO Optimization โ€” Use keywords that parents search for, like 'educational videos for kids' in titles, descriptions, and tags.
  • Compelling Content โ€” Post high-quality, engaging videos that promote learning in fun ways โ€” think songs, animations, and interactive lessons.
  • Playlists and Series โ€” Organize videos into playlists and series to encourage binge-watching and increase watch time.
  • Engage with Comments โ€” Respond to viewers' comments and questions to build a community and encourage return visits.

Leverage Social Media Platforms

Social media can be a powerful tool for reaching parents and promoting your channel.

  • Facebook Groups โ€” Join parenting groups and share your videos as resources. Ensure you follow group rules for promotion.
  • Instagram Reels โ€” Create short clips of your videos to share on Instagram, tagging relevant hashtags like #KidsEducation.
  • TikTok Clips โ€” Post engaging snippets of your educational content to attract a younger audience and their parents.
  • Pinterest Boards โ€” Create boards with educational resources linking back to your videos, targeting parents looking for teaching materials.
  • Collaborate with Influencers โ€” Partner with parenting influencers to reach their audience through shoutouts or collaborative videos.

Content Collaborations

Partnering with others can expand your reach and introduce your content to new audiences.

  • Collaborate with Other YouTubers โ€” Create joint videos with channels that have a similar target audience.
  • Guest Appearances โ€” Offer to appear on podcasts or webinars focused on parenting or education.
  • Shared Giveaways โ€” Collaborate on giveaways that require participants to follow both channels.
  • Resource Sharing โ€” Share educational resources and videos with other creators to cross-promote each other's content.
  • Community Challenges โ€” Create challenges that involve multiple content creators, encouraging viewers to engage with all involved.

How do I create engaging content for kids?
Focus on colorful visuals, interactive lessons, and relatable characters. Test your content with your audience to see what resonates best.
